Smoke odor requires thermal fogging to reach residue that settled into the same spaces the smoke originally penetrated.
Enzymatic pre-treatment breaks down pet odor sources in flooring and padding before ozone or hydroxyl treatment finishes the job.
We treat lingering biological odor as a distinct phase, running equipment until testing confirms the smell is gone.
Musty odor tied to moisture problems gets addressed alongside any underlying mold issue, not just treated at the surface.
Ductwork that has absorbed odor recirculates it through the whole property until it's specifically treated or cleaned.

Treatment can take anywhere from several hours to a few days depending on how deeply the odor has penetrated materials.

Ozone is effective but requires an empty space during treatment, unlike hydroxyl generators which are safe for occupied rooms.
